本発明は冷気通路を備えた冷蔵庫に関する。   The present invention relates to a refrigerator having a cold air passage.

従来の冷蔵庫は特許文献1に開示されている。この冷蔵庫は断熱箱体の上部に貯蔵物を冷蔵保存する冷蔵室(第1冷蔵室)が配され、冷蔵室の下方には貯蔵物を冷蔵保存する野菜室(第2冷蔵室)が配される。野菜室の下方には貯蔵物を冷凍保存する冷凍室が上下に並設されている。   A conventional refrigerator is disclosed in Patent Document 1. The refrigerator is provided with a refrigerator compartment (first refrigerator compartment) for storing stored items in the upper part of the heat insulation box, and a vegetable compartment (second refrigerator compartment) for storing stored items under the refrigerator compartment. The Below the vegetable compartment, a freezer compartment for storing stored items in a frozen state is arranged vertically.

最下段の冷凍室の背面側には機械室が設けられ、機械室には冷凍サイクルを運転する圧縮機が配されている。   A machine room is provided on the back side of the lowermost freezer compartment, and a compressor for operating the refrigerating cycle is arranged in the machine room.

冷凍室の後部には冷却器、送風ファン及びダンパを配して冷気が流通する冷気通路が設けられている。冷気通路には冷凍室に臨む吐出口及び戻り口、冷蔵室に臨む吐出口、野菜室に臨む戻り口がそれぞれ開口する。また、冷蔵室には冷気を野菜室に導く連通路が導出されている。   A cool air passage through which cool air flows is provided at the rear of the freezer compartment by providing a cooler, a blower fan, and a damper. A discharge port and a return port facing the freezer compartment, a discharge port facing the refrigerator compartment, and a return port facing the vegetable chamber are opened in the cold air passage. In the refrigerator compartment, a communication path for guiding cold air to the vegetable compartment is led out.

上記構成の冷蔵庫において、圧縮機及び送風ファンの駆動によって冷気通路を流通する空気と冷却器とが熱交換して生成された冷気が吐出口から冷凍室に吐出される。吐出口から吐出された冷気は冷凍室内を流通し、戻り口を介して冷却器に戻る。   In the refrigerator having the above configuration, cold air generated by heat exchange between the air flowing through the cold air passage and the cooler by driving the compressor and the blower fan is discharged from the discharge port to the freezer compartment. The cold air discharged from the discharge port flows through the freezer compartment and returns to the cooler through the return port.

また、ダンパが開かれると冷気は冷蔵室の吐出口から吐出され、戻り口に戻り連通路を介して野菜室内に流入する。野菜室内を流通した冷気は戻り口を介して冷却器に戻る。これにより、冷凍室、冷蔵室及び野菜室内が冷却される。   When the damper is opened, cold air is discharged from the discharge port of the refrigerator compartment, returns to the return port, and flows into the vegetable compartment through the communication path. The cold air circulated through the vegetable compartment returns to the cooler through the return port. Thereby, a freezer compartment, a refrigerator compartment, and a vegetable compartment are cooled.

特開平9−113108号公報JP-A-9-113108

しかしながら、従来の冷蔵庫によると、冷却器で生成された冷気は野菜室の背面に配置された冷気通路を介して冷蔵室に流入する。冷気が野菜室の後方を流通する際に、冷気の温度が上昇してしまう虞がある。このため、冷蔵庫の冷却能力が低下するという問題があった。   However, according to the conventional refrigerator, the cold air generated by the cooler flows into the refrigerating room through the cold air passage disposed on the back surface of the vegetable room. When cold air circulates behind the vegetable compartment, the temperature of the cold air may increase. For this reason, there existed a problem that the cooling capacity of a refrigerator fell.

本発明は、冷却能力を向上できる冷蔵庫を提供することを目的とする。   An object of this invention is to provide the refrigerator which can improve cooling capacity.

図5は冷気通路7の上部通路9の下部及び冷却器室12の斜視図を示している。図6は野菜室5の概略斜視図を示している。上部通路9の右側壁9dと冷却器室12の上壁12bとの間は傾斜面12aにより連結される。これにより、左右幅の大きい冷却器室12から冷凍区画部21(図1参照)の後方に配した左右幅の狭い上部通路9に円滑に冷気が流入する。従って、冷気通路7の圧力損失を低減することができる。   FIG. 5 shows a perspective view of the lower part of the upper passage 9 of the cool air passage 7 and the cooler chamber 12. FIG. 6 shows a schematic perspective view of the vegetable compartment 5. The right side wall 9d of the upper passage 9 and the upper wall 12b of the cooler chamber 12 are connected by an inclined surface 12a. As a result, the cool air smoothly flows from the cooler chamber 12 having a large lateral width into the upper passage 9 having a narrow lateral width disposed behind the freezing compartment 21 (see FIG. 1). Therefore, the pressure loss of the cool air passage 7 can be reduced.

この時、野菜室5の底壁を形成する仕切部19の後部と左側壁を形成する仕切部20の後部との間には傾斜面12aとの干渉を回避する回避部5dが設けられる。回避部5dは仕切部19、仕切部20により一体で形成され、回避部5d内には断熱材13が充填されている。尚、野菜室5内の収納ケース50(図4参照)の側壁と底壁との間には回避部5dとの干渉を回避する面取り(不図示)が形成される。   At this time, an avoiding part 5d for avoiding interference with the inclined surface 12a is provided between the rear part of the partition part 19 forming the bottom wall of the vegetable compartment 5 and the rear part of the partition part 20 forming the left side wall. The avoidance part 5d is integrally formed by the partition part 19 and the partition part 20, and the avoidance part 5d is filled with the heat insulating material 13. In addition, chamfering (not shown) which avoids interference with the avoidance part 5d is formed between the side wall and bottom wall of the storage case 50 (see FIG. 4) in the vegetable compartment 5.

上記構成の冷蔵庫1において、圧縮機31及び送風ファン10の駆動によって冷却器室12を流通する空気と冷却器11とが熱交換して冷気が生成される。生成された冷気は吐出口9aから製氷室25に吐出され、吐出口9bから冷凍室26に吐出される。また、冷気は下部通路29を流通して吐出口29a、29b、29cから冷凍室6に吐出される。吐出された冷気は製氷室25、冷凍室26及び冷凍室6内を流通し、戻り口9cを介して冷却器11に戻る。これにより、製氷室25、冷凍室26及び冷凍室6内の冷却が行われる。   In the refrigerator 1 having the above configuration, the air flowing through the cooler chamber 12 and the cooler 11 exchange heat by driving the compressor 31 and the blower fan 10 to generate cold air. The generated cold air is discharged from the discharge port 9a to the ice making chamber 25 and discharged from the discharge port 9b to the freezing chamber 26. Further, the cold air flows through the lower passage 29 and is discharged from the discharge ports 29a, 29b, 29c to the freezer compartment 6. The discharged cold air flows through the ice making chamber 25, the freezing chamber 26 and the freezing chamber 6 and returns to the cooler 11 through the return port 9c. Thereby, the inside of the ice making room 25, the freezing room 26, and the freezing room 6 is cooled.

ダンパ23が開かれると上部通路9の冷蔵用通路8に冷気が流入し、吐出口8a、8b、8c、8d、8e、8fから冷蔵室4に吐出される。吐出された冷気は冷蔵室4の前方へ流通した後に下方に流通し、連通口4fから流出する。これにより、冷蔵室4内の冷却が行われる。   When the damper 23 is opened, cold air flows into the refrigeration passage 8 of the upper passage 9 and is discharged from the discharge ports 8a, 8b, 8c, 8d, 8e, 8f to the refrigeration chamber 4. The discharged cool air flows to the front of the refrigerator compartment 4 and then flows downward, and flows out from the communication port 4f. Thereby, the inside of the refrigerator compartment 4 is cooled.

その後、連通口4fを介して冷気は野菜室5内に吐出され、野菜室5内の前部から後部へと流通し、戻り通路34を介して冷却器室12に戻る。これにより、野菜室5内の冷却が行われる。   Thereafter, the cold air is discharged into the vegetable compartment 5 through the communication port 4 f, circulates from the front to the rear in the vegetable compartment 5, and returns to the cooler compartment 12 through the return passage 34. Thereby, cooling in the vegetable compartment 5 is performed.

本実施形態によると、冷気通路7が冷却器11を設置する冷却器室12と、冷却器室12から上方に延びる上部通路9とを有する。また、冷却器室12は冷凍区画部21の下方から野菜室5の下方に亘って設けられ、上部通路9は野菜室5の後方を避けて冷凍区画部21の後方に設けられる。このため、冷却器11で生成された冷気が野菜室5の後方を避けて配される上部通路9を介して冷蔵室4、冷凍区画部21及び冷凍室6に供給される。このため、上部通路9を流通する冷気の昇温を抑制し、冷蔵庫1の冷却能力を向上することができる。   According to this embodiment, the cool air passage 7 has a cooler chamber 12 in which the cooler 11 is installed, and an upper passage 9 that extends upward from the cooler chamber 12. The cooler chamber 12 is provided from the lower side of the freezing compartment 21 to the lower side of the vegetable compartment 5, and the upper passage 9 is provided behind the freezing compartment 21 while avoiding the rear of the vegetable compartment 5. For this reason, the cold air | gas produced | generated with the cooler 11 is supplied to the refrigerator compartment 4, the freezer compartment 21, and the freezer compartment 6 via the upper channel | path 9 distribute | arranged avoiding the back of the vegetable compartment 5. FIG. For this reason, the temperature rise of the cold air which distribute | circulates the upper channel | path 9 can be suppressed, and the cooling capacity of the refrigerator 1 can be improved.

また、冷気通路7の下部通路29が送風ファン10(第1送風機)の下流で上部通路9から分岐して下方に延び、送風ファン10が正面投影において仕切部36に重なる位置に配される。このため、上部通路9から分岐して送風ファン10により冷気が送出される下部通路29の長さを短縮することができる。従って、冷気通路7の圧力損失を低減することができる。   Further, the lower passage 29 of the cool air passage 7 branches from the upper passage 9 downstream of the blower fan 10 (first blower) and extends downward, and the blower fan 10 is disposed at a position overlapping the partition portion 36 in front projection. For this reason, the length of the lower passage 29 branched from the upper passage 9 and cooled by the blower fan 10 can be shortened. Therefore, the pressure loss of the cool air passage 7 can be reduced.

また、上部通路9の側壁9dと冷却器室12の上壁12bとを傾斜面12aにより連結したため、冷却器室12から上部通路9へ冷気を流れやすくすることができる。   Further, since the side wall 9d of the upper passage 9 and the upper wall 12b of the cooler chamber 12 are connected by the inclined surface 12a, the cool air can easily flow from the cooler chamber 12 to the upper passage 9.

Next, FIG. 7 has shown the front view of the main-body part 2 of the refrigerator 1 of 2nd Embodiment. For convenience of explanation, the same reference numerals are given to the same parts as those in the first embodiment shown in FIGS. In the present embodiment, the shape of the upper passage 9 is different from that of the first embodiment. Other parts are the same as those in the first embodiment.

上部通路9には送風ファン10とダンパ23との間を鉛直に延びる仕切壁32cにより左右に分割された分割通路32a、32bが設けられる。左方の分割通路32bには吐出口9a、9bが開口し、右方の分割通路32aによって送風ファン10とダンパ23とが連結される。   The upper passage 9 is provided with divided passages 32a and 32b divided into left and right by a partition wall 32c extending vertically between the blower fan 10 and the damper 23. Discharge ports 9a and 9b are opened in the left divided passage 32b, and the blower fan 10 and the damper 23 are connected by the right divided passage 32a.

これにより、ダンパ23を開いた際にダンパ23よりも上方の冷蔵用通路8に冷気を円滑に導くことができる。また、吐出口9a、9bからの冷気吐出による冷蔵用通路8に導かれる冷気の減少を防止できる。従って、冷蔵室4及び野菜室5の冷却時の冷凍室6、26及び製氷室25の過冷却を低減することができる。   Thus, when the damper 23 is opened, the cool air can be smoothly guided to the refrigeration passage 8 above the damper 23. Further, it is possible to prevent a decrease in the cool air guided to the refrigeration passage 8 due to the cool air discharge from the discharge ports 9a and 9b. Therefore, it is possible to reduce overcooling of the freezing rooms 6 and 26 and the ice making room 25 when the refrigerator compartment 4 and the vegetable compartment 5 are cooled.

また、上部通路9に分割通路32a、32bを設けない場合、冷却器11が目詰まりして送風ファン10から製氷室25の吐出口9aまでの上部通路9の風量が低下すると、ダンパ23が開いて送風ファン24を駆動させた時に、吐出口9aから冷気を吸い込む逆流が発生することがある。しかしながら、送風ファン10から送出された冷気がすぐに分割通路32aおよび分割通路32bにより分岐されるので、吐出口9aからの逆流を確実に防止し、冷蔵庫1の冷却効率を向上できる。   Further, if the upper passage 9 is not provided with the divided passages 32a and 32b, the damper 23 opens when the cooler 11 is clogged and the air volume of the upper passage 9 from the blower fan 10 to the discharge port 9a of the ice making chamber 25 decreases. When the blower fan 24 is driven, a reverse flow that sucks cold air from the discharge port 9a may occur. However, since the cool air sent from the blower fan 10 is immediately branched by the divided passage 32a and the divided passage 32b, the backflow from the discharge port 9a can be reliably prevented and the cooling efficiency of the refrigerator 1 can be improved.

本実施形態によると、第1実施形態と同様の効果を得ることができる。また、上部通路9が分割通路32a、32bを有するので、冷蔵用通路8に冷気を円滑に導くことができるとともに、冷凍室6、26及び製氷室25の過冷却を低減することができる。   According to this embodiment, the same effect as that of the first embodiment can be obtained. Moreover, since the upper channel | path 9 has the division | segmentation channel | paths 32a and 32b, while being able to guide cold to the refrigeration channel | path 8 smoothly, overcooling of the freezer compartments 6 and 26 and the ice making chamber 25 can be reduced.
